#!/bin/bash
PROGNAME=`basename $0`
CONTROLLER_NAME=$1
CONTROLLER_DISK_SIZE=$2
CONTROLLER_MEM=$3
COMPUTE_NAME=$4
COMPUTE_DISK_SIZE=$5
COMPUTE_MEM=$6
ROOTPW=$7
IMAGES_HOME=/var/lib/libvirt/images
CONTROLLER_IMAGE=$IMAGES_HOME/$CONTROLLER_NAME.qcow2
COMPUTE_IMAGE=$IMAGES_HOME/$COMPUTE_NAME.qcow2
usage () {
echo -e "
***NOTE***: Ensure you have at-least 100G free disk space and
10G of free memory available before you invoke
this script.
Usage: ./$PROGNAME CONTROLLER_NAME CONTROLLER_DISK_SIZE \\ \n \
CONTROLLER_MEM COMPUTE_NAME \\ \n \
COMPUTE_DISK_SIZE COMPUTE_MEM ROOTPW
This script aims to setup two virtual machines -- first one, an
OpenStack Controller node; second one, OpenStack Compute node.
Examples:
Create a Controller node with 40G disk, 4096MB memory and
a Compute node with 50G disk, 6144MB memory with root
password as 'fedora':
./$PROGNAME controller 40G 4096 compute 50G 6144 fedora
Create a Controller node with 80G disk, 4096MB memory and
a Compute node with 120G disk, 8192MB memory, with root
password as 'fedora':
./$PROGNAME controller 80G 4096 compute 120G 8192 fedora
"
}
# This must be run as root
check_if_root() {
if [ `id -u` -ne 0 ] ; then
echo "Please run as 'root' to execute $PROGNAME."
exit 1
fi
}
# Check free memory on the host
check_free_mem() {
echo "Checking for free memory on your host. . ."
FREEMEM=$(free -m | awk 'NR==3 {print $4}')
if [ "$FREEMEM" -lt "10000" ]; then
echo "Please ensure you have at-least 10G of free memory"
exit 255
fi
}
set_root_passwd() {
# Create a secure tmp directory
tmp=`(umask 077 && mktemp "vmpwdXXXXXXX") 2>/dev/null` && test $tmp
echo "Create root password for virtual machines. . ."
echo $ROOTPW > $tmp
}
create_nodes() {
# Create Controller node
echo "Preparing Controller node disk image. . ."
virt-builder fedora-20 \
--update \
--selinux-relabel \
--format qcow2 \
--size $CONTROLLER_DISK_SIZE \
--root-password file:$tmp \
-o $IMAGES_HOME/$CONTROLLER_NAME.qcow2
# Create Compute node
echo "Preparing Compute node disk image. . ."
virt-builder fedora-20 \
--update \
--selinux-relabel \
--format qcow2 \
--size $COMPUTE_DISK_SIZE \
--root-password file:$tmp \
-o $IMAGES_HOME/$COMPUTE_NAME.qcow2
rm $tmp
return 0
}
# FIXME: Import with openstack libvirt networks
import_nodes_into_libvirt() {
# Import the virtual machines into libvirt
echo "Importing Controller and Compute images into libvirt. . ."
virt-install --name controller \
--ram $CONTROLLER_MEM \
--disk path=$CONTROLLER_IMAGE,format=qcow2 \
--import --noautoconsole --noreboot
# Import the Compute node disk image into libvirt
virt-install --name compute \
--ram $COMPUTE_MEM \
--disk path=$COMPUTE_IMAGE,format=qcow2 \
--import --noautoconsole --noreboot
return 0
}
check_kvm_nesting() {
CHECK_NESTING=$(cat /sys/module/kvm_intel/parameters/nested)
if [ "$CHECK_NESTING" != "Y" ]; then
echo "Please ensure you enable nested virt"
echo "To enable nested virt, add 'options kvm-intel nested=y'
(without quotes) to '/etc/modprobe.d/dist.conf', & reboot the
host."
exit 255
fi
}
enable_nested_virt() {
echo "Setup netsted virt on Compute host. . ."
virt-xml compute \
--edit \
--cpu host-passthrough,clearxml=yes
}
create_snapshot() {
# Take snapshots
echo "Taking snapshots. . ."
virsh snapshot-create-as \
controller snap1 "Pristine Fedora"
virsh snapshot-create-as \
compute snap1 "Pristine Fedora"
return 0
}
start_nodes() {
echo "Starting Controller and Compute nodes. . ."
virsh start controller
virsh start compute
}
# main()
{
# check if min no. of arguments are 6
if [ "$#" != 7 ]; then
usage
exit 255
fi
check_if_root
check_free_mem
set_root_passwd
create_nodes
import_nodes_into_libvirt
check_kvm_nesting
enable_nested_virt
create_snapshot
start_nodes
}
